一、什么是区块链合约?

区块链合约是基于区块链技术构建的数字,主要功能是支持用户存储、管理和转移加密资产。在传统金融系统中,通常指的是物理形式的存储工具,而在数字货币领域,则是一个软件或硬件的应用。合约的特指在于其能够支持智能合约的执行。智能合约是运行在区块链平台上的代码逻辑,可以自动执行合约条款。在这样的背景下,合约不仅仅是资产的存储工具,它还能够通过智能合约,实现自动化的资产管理和交易。

与传统的相比,区块链合约具有去中心化的特性,用户不再依赖中介机构来管理资产。这种方式降低了各种交易的成本和时间,同时也提升了交易的透明度和安全性。用户可以通过合约配置不同的智能合约,从而满足个性化需求。举例来说,用户可以创建一个在达到特定条件时自动转移资产的合约,从而使得资产管理更加灵活,并且大幅增加了应用场景。

二、合约的运作机制

合约的核心在于智能合约的编程逻辑。建立一个合约,用户首先需要在区块链网络上创建一个智能合约。这一智能合约将定义资产的存储、转移和管理方式。合约通常会包括一些特定的功能,如多重签名、权限控制等,以满足不同用户的需求。

例如,用户在指令合约进行转账时,实际执行的过程是智能合约通过预设的条件判断是否满足,然后自动进行资金的转移。这种自动执行的能力极大地提升了操作的效率,减少了人为错误。同时,合约还可以编写出复杂的交易逻辑,比如自动化的定期存款或者周期性支付,这在传统金融工具中往往需要复杂的流程。

三、合约的优势与劣势

像所有的技术方案一样,区块链合约也有其明显的优势和劣势。

从优势来说,合约的去中心化特性和透明性是其最大的优势。在区块链上,所有的交易记录都是公开且不可篡改的,这样用户可以实时追踪交易的状态和资金的流动。此外,合约定义灵活,用户可以根据自身需求设定多种自动流转机制。这些优势使得用户对合约的接受度越来越高。

尽管如此,合约在使用中也存在一些劣势。首先,智能合约一旦部署,代码的错误可能导致资金无法找回。除此之外,合约的复杂性增加了使用的门槛,普通用户可能需要一定的技术背景才能充分利用其功能。最后,在法律和政策方面,合约在很多国家和地区仍然处于灰色地带,缺乏明确的监管和法律支持。

四、合约的应用场景

合约的应用场景非常广泛。以下是几个典型的应用案例。

1. **去中心化金融(DeFi)**: 合约为DeFi协议提供了必要的基础设施,使用户在无需中介的情况下,可以自由地进行借贷、交易和流动性提供。用户可以利用合约参与各种流动性池,自动进行收益农业。同时,很多 DeFi 协议都需要用户设置合约来处理复杂的资产管理。

2. **数字资产管理**: 合约可以帮助用户为多种数字资产(如 NFT、代币)配置不同的管理策略。通过智能合约,用户能够设定资产的转移规则和条件,有效避免资产流失的风险。

3. **定期支付和工资发放**: 企业可以使用合约进行工资的自动发放,通过智能合约设定发放频率和金额,保证流水的透明化和自动化,提高企业财务管理效率。

4. **众筹项目**: 合约也能够应用于众筹项目,通过智能合约管理资金的分配和使用,设定特定条件达到后才能解锁资金。这在一些项目中提高了透明度,保护了投资者的权益。

5. **保险理赔**: 区块链合约的可以用于保险领域,通过条件触发的智能合约来实现自动理赔。例如,当事故发生并符合特定条件后,合约会自动将保险金转到账户中,减少理赔的时间。

五、未来的发展趋势

随着技术的不断进步,区块链合约的发展将面临以下几个趋势:

1. **用户友好性提升**: 未来的合约将更注重用户体验,通过简化界面和操作,提高普通用户的使用便捷性。同时,一些项目也在不断完善用户教育,帮助用户理解智能合约及其应用。

2. **合规化**: 随着各国对加密货币的监管政策不断收紧,合约在合规性上将更加重视,这样才能更好地融入传统金融体系,提升用户的信任度。

3. **跨链功能**: 随着不同区块链网络的发展,合约也将向跨链整合发展,使用户能够在不同的区块链之间自由移动资产。在这方面的突破将极大地提升资金流动性。

4. **智能合约的持续**: 一些新的编程语言和工具正在不断出现,专门针对智能合约的开发进行,包括安全性、可扩展性等。未来的合约将受益于这些技术成果。

5. **增加隐私功能**: 随着用户对隐私保护的需求增强,未来的合约也将会投入更多资源在技术的研发上,争取在满足透明性与合规性的同时,保障用户的隐私。

六、常见问题解答

1. 区块链合约是否安全?

安全性是大多数用户在选择区块链合约时最关心的话题之一。合约的安全主要取决于其智能合约的编写质量和用户的操作习惯。

首先,区块链技术本身的去中心化特性提供了数据伪造的困难,所有交易记录都被永久存储在区块链上。然而,合约的安全问题多半集中在智能合约的代码层面,若代码中存在漏洞,黑客可能会利用这些漏洞进行攻击,导致用户资产损失。因此,在选择合约时,用户应选择信誉较高的项目,这些项目通常会经过专业的代码审计,提高安全性。

此外,用户自身的安全措施同样重要,例如要确保私钥和助记词的保管妥当,不要随便点击陌生链接和下载不明应用。很多资金损失其实是由于用户的操作不当所致,而不是合约本身的安全问题。

2. 如何创建和使用合约?

创建和使用合约的流程相对简单,但需要一定的技术基础。首先,用户需选择一个支持智能合约的区块链平台,如以太坊,然后使用与之兼容的工具(如 MetaMask)进行创建。

在创建合约之后,用户需要编写智能合约代码。这可以通过使用 Solidity 等智能合约编程语言完成。合约的代码定义了资产的存储规则和交易条件。在编写完成后,用户需要将合约部署到区块链上,通常需要支付一些矿工费用。在合约部署后,用户就可以通过与合约进行交互,执行转账或调用合约中的其他功能。

使用时,用户可以通过界面进行操作,通常会提供直观的界面引导用户完成各项功能。同时,提供丰富的自定义设置,用户可以根据自身需求配置合约逻辑。

3. 合约如何参与DeFi项目?

DeFi(去中心化金融)是区块链技术应用中一个热门领域,合约在其中的作用非常关键。

参与DeFi项目,用户首先需要拥有支持ERC-20代币或其他特定资产的合约。在选择DeFi协议时,用户应当了解该平台的机制和风险。在确认后,用户可以将资产存入DeFi协议。比如,在流动性挖掘中,用户可以通过合约提供资产流动性,作为回报获取一定的利息或额外代币。

为了参与DeFi项目,用户需对智能合约的运作有基本了解,明白在什么条件下会自动执行哪些操作,以及在何种情况下能获得收益。同时,用户要确保资产的安全,避免在选择项目时被不良项目所欺诈。

4. 如何保障合约的私密性?

保障合约的私密性,用户应采取以下几个措施。

首先,用户在创建时,切忌使用简单的密码。应使用复杂的密码,且不常用于其他平台。同时,为了增加安全性,用户可以启用两因素认证(2FA),这个功能在大多数应用程序中都能够找到。

其次,用户应当妥善保管助记词和私钥。这些信息是获取的唯一凭证,若被他人获取,将有可能导致资产损失。用户应使用硬件进行私钥的存储,避免将其存放在网络环境中,比如邮件或文本信息中。

再者,用户在进行交易时,应时刻注意所连接的网络。例如,在公共Wi-Fi环境下尽量避免进行敏感操作,尽可能在安全的网络中进行资产管理。同时,用户应定期查看合约中的交易记录,确认是否有异常交易。

5. 未来合约的发展方向是什么?

未来,合约将朝着多元化、智能化和合规化的方向发展。

首先,合约可能会整合更多功能,使其不仅限于存储和转移资产。未来可以集成资产管理、信贷、投资及更多金融服务,为用户提供一站式的资金管理解决方案。

其次,智能合约的复杂性和安全性会持续。随着新一代的编程语言的出现,智能合约的代码将更加高效可靠,同时配合更加强大的审计工具,提升整个合约系统的安全性和用户的信任度。

最后,合规化将成为合约发展的必要趋势。监管机构对于区块链技术的关注与日俱增,合约未来需要更多地关注合规性问题,这样才能更好地融入主流金融体系,获得更多用户的接受度。

综上所述,区块链合约具有广泛的应用前景和发展潜力,用户在享受其便捷服务的同时,应充分了解相关知识,以提高自身资产的安全性和管理效率。